Sensodyne Toothpaste Deep Clean Review
Thanks to BzzAgent, I got a 4 oz tube of my almost-favorite toothpaste for free! Now I try it out and report back on social media. So, here's my first post.
I always did like Sensodyne, but I quit buying it because the other brands came out with a style for sensitive teeth that was cheaper.
Then, I got hooked up with Wellness Mama and started going all natural, trying to avoid flouride. So I made my own toothpaste and have been using that.
But BzzAgent was too good to pass up. So I'm back even though this tube of Sensodyne, which states it is the #1 Dentist Recommended Brand for Sensitive Teeth, clearly has flouride. (sadly)
It DOES help my teeth feel better. They are sensitive to hot and cold and often hurt, but since I've been using this toothpaste twice a day (ok, sometimes three), they are much better. I have a dental appointment tomorrow that will tell the tale.
Do I like that the ingredients list has things included that I can't pronounce? Not much, and because of that AND the flouride, I probably will not continue to use Sensodyne. But, thanks, BzzAgent, for letting me try it again for free. AND I got a coupon for $1 off.
